### Step 7 — Clock Skew Check

Build agents in the Pinewharf pool have drifted up to 40s apart, which breaks timestamp validation on signed manifests. Before approving a deploy of the Cinderbolt pipeline, confirm all agents synced against the internal time source within the last hour; the preflight script prints per-agent offsets. Reject anything over 2s. Once skew is within tolerance, re-run manifest signing so timestamps are consistent. Verification requires the pool deploy key, which is as follows.

release key, yagap-kagag: bky6_1ks93y

**Runbook: Splitting the user module out of Corewall**

Support folks: during the split, account lookups may briefly route to both the Corewall monolith and the new Userhive service. Expect duplicate audit entries for up to ten minutes after each cutover window; these are harmless and reconciled nightly. If a customer reports a login loop, check whether their shard has been migrated before escalating to the Userhive team. The routing layer decides per shard using the configuration below.

service settings:
PRAWYN_PIN=9848
PRAWYN_METRICS_HOST=metrics.prawyn.lumicworks.corp
PRAWYN_LOG_LEVEL=warn
PRAWYN_TENANT=pelius

Minutes — Management Meeting, Capacity Decision

Attendees reviewed utilisation at the Tarwick plant, now at peak. Agreed to defer a second line pending demand data from the Ellshore launch. Finance to model both scenarios by month-end. The incoming director will own the final recommendation. Background on the plan is given in the confidential note below.

confidential, kagep-kahof: Druokax Systems plans to lower the Ulaath list price by 53 percent in March.

**Mgmt Meeting Minutes — Retiring the Brightline Range**

Quick recap for sales leads at Fenholt Supplies: we agreed to retire the Brightline fixture range by year-end. Remaining stock moves to clearance pricing next month, and accounts on standing orders get migrated to the Lumetta range. Trade-in incentives were approved in principle. The confidential note on next steps sits just below.

board note of bajof-bajeg: The pricing group signed off on a budget of $13.4 million for Project Sildor. The renewal with Lamixek Holdings closes at $48.9 million a year, 49 percent above the last contract.